Step 1: Initial Setup and Installation

This begins long before delivery. First, secure a suitable site with proper zoning permits. Prepare a level foundation, typically a concrete pad. Coordinate the delivery logistics for a large truck and crane. Upon arrival, the unit is craned onto the foundation. The “quick installation” then involves connecting pre-installed utility chases to your site’s water, sewer, electrical, and gas lines. This phase requires licensed professionals. If you ordered multiple units, they are now joined using the integrated connection system.

Step 6: Troubleshooting Common Issues

Issue: Condensation inside. Solution: Ensure your HVAC system is adequately sized and the insulation vapor barrier wasn’t compromised during customization. Increase ventilation.
Issue: Door/window difficult to open. Solution: The unit may have settled slightly. Adjust the hinge mechanisms or latch alignment.

Expert Tips for Maximum Value

Tip #1: Invest in Comprehensive Customization Upfront

Work closely with the manufacturer to design the interior layout, electrical, and plumbing for your specific equipment. It’s far cheaper and easier to do this in the factory than to retrofit later.

Tip #2: Prioritize Site Preparation

Don’t let the “quick install” promise make you complacent. Have your foundation, permits, and utility stubs 100% ready before the unit arrives to avoid costly delays.

Tip #3: Plan for Climate Control

Spring for the higher-grade insulation package if you’re in a region with extreme temperatures. Also, ensure you budget for a sufficiently powerful, commercial-grade HVAC system to keep staff and customers comfortable, making your steel container cafe worth it year-round.

Tip #4: Maximize Vertical Space

Use the high ceilings (often 9.5ft) to your advantage. Install high shelving, hanging pot racks, or even a mezzanine level for storage or office space to overcome the limited floor width.

Tip #5: Create a Cohesive Exterior Brand

Use the large, flat exterior walls as a canvas. Professional signage, integrated lighting, and a well-designed patio area can transform the unit from a container into a destination.

Tip #6: Factor in All Associated Costs

Create a budget that includes the unit, delivery, crane service, foundation, utility hookups, interior finishes/appliances, and landscaping. This will give you a true picture of whether this is the best prefabricated container restaurant investment for your capital.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  1. Mistake: Ordering the unit before securing permits and a site. → Solution: Complete all local zoning and health department approvals first. The unit specifications will often be required for these permits.
  2. Mistake: Under-budgeting for site work and utilities. → Solution: Get multiple quotes from local contractors for foundation and utility connection work before finalizing your total project budget.
  3. Mistake: Choosing the cheapest insulation option in a harsh climate. → Solution: View insulation and HVAC as critical operational costs, not areas to cut corners. Better efficiency saves money monthly.
  4. Mistake: Not planning for waste and storage. → Solution: Designate space for dumpsters, dry storage, and staff areas in your initial layout to avoid a cramped, inefficient workflow.
  5. Mistake: Assuming it’s 100% maintenance-free. → Solution: Schedule bi-annual inspections of seals, paint, and roof drainage to ensure the longevity of your container restaurant worth buying.

Can I really move it after it’s installed?

Yes, that’s one of its key advantages. However, moving it is a non-trivial expense. You’ll need to hire a crane service to lift it onto a flatbed truck, pay for transportation, and then have another crane at the new site to place it on a new foundation. It’s feasible for a permanent relocation but not for daily or weekly moves.

Is it comfortable for customers in extreme weather?

With the proper insulation package and a correctly sized HVAC system, it can be just as comfortable as any traditional building. The insulated panels are effective, but the metal exterior can transfer temperature, making climate control a critical budget item. Never skip on insulation or HVAC capacity.
